WebAug 7, 2024 · Avoid convenience foods such as canned soups, entrees, vegetables, pasta and rice mixes, frozen dinners, instant cereal and puddings, and gravy sauce mixes. Select frozen meals that contain around 600 mg sodium or less. Use fresh, frozen, no-added-salt canned vegetables, low-sodium soups, and low-sodium lunchmeats. WebJul 22, 2024 · Serving size matters. A large serving of low-potassium food can turn into a high-potassium food. Aim for 2-3 servings of low potassium fruits each day. You can leach potassium from vegetables before cooking. Leaching is a process by which some potassium can be pulled out of the vegetable. Learn how to leach vegetables.
